Fix LDM addressing mode disassembly
The Pixelflinger disassembler does not handle LDM addressing modes correctly,
assuming that the P and U bits in the instruction mean the same in both LDM and
STM. This results in the disassembler producing sequences like:
stmfd r13!, {r4-r11, r14}
...
...
...
ldmea r13!, {r4-r11, r14}
This small patch fixes it by EORing the P and U bits with the Load/Store bit.
